Kinds Of Replacement Windows

When picking replacement windows, house owners have numerous choices to think about:

1. Double-Hung Windows

Double-hung windows feature two operable sashes, enabling ventilation from both the top and the bottom. They are easy to clean and provide great air flow.

2. Sash Windows

These windows are depended upon one side and open outward, offering complete ventilation, maximum views, and easy cleansing.

3. Moving Windows

Sliding windows move horizontally and can be simpler to open than conventional designs. They're great for spaces where you wish to maximize natural light.

4. Photo Windows

Fixed and non-operable, image windows are designed to provide expansive views and natural light without jeopardizing energy effectiveness.

5. Bay and Bow Windows

These windows extend outside the wall, developing an architectural centerpiece. They offer potential additional seating or display space inside.

6. Awning Windows

Hinged at the leading, awning windows open external and are perfect for ventilation during rain, as they keep the interior dry while allowing airflow.

Types of Replacement Doors

Similar to windows, doors are available in numerous ranges, each serving various functions and designs.

1. Entry Doors

These doors act as the primary entrance, offering security and style. Numerous property owners choose fiberglass or steel for resilience and energy effectiveness.

2. Outdoor patio Doors

Typically set up to link indoor areas to outside areas, patio area doors can be moving or French doors, supplying beautiful views and simple access to patio areas or decks.

3. Storm Doors

Storm doors add an extra layer of protection against the elements. They can help insulate your home and safeguard your primary door from weather damage.

4. Bi-Fold Doors

These doors consist of several panels that fold open like an accordion, enabling for broad openings and seamless transitions between indoor and outdoor spaces.

Expenses of Replacement Windows and Doors

The expense of replacing windows and doors can vary greatly based on factors such as material option, framing design, installation costs, and the variety of units being changed. Below is a general cost estimate for different kinds of doors and windows:

TypeTypical Cost per Unit
Double-Hung Window₤ 300 - ₤ 800
Sash Window₤ 400 - ₤ 1000
Sliding Window₤ 300 - ₤ 1200
Photo Window₤ 400 - ₤ 3000
Entry Door₤ 400 - ₤ 3000
Outdoor patio Door₤ 800 - ₤ 3000
Storm Door₤ 100 - ₤ 500
Bi-Fold Door₤ 3500 - ₤ 6000

Note: Prices may differ based on area, brand name, and the specifics of the installation procedure.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How long do replacement windows last?

A1: Windows typically last anywhere from 15 to 30 years, depending on the material, installation quality, and climate conditions.

Q2: Will brand-new windows actually conserve me cash on energy expenses?

A2: Yes, energy-efficient windows can considerably decrease heating and cooling costs by avoiding drafts and enhancing insulation.

Q3: Can I set up replacement windows myself?

A3: While DIY installation is possible, it is extremely recommended to hire specialists to guarantee proper fitting and sealing, as mistakes can lead to moisture concerns or air leaks.

Q4: What should I try to find when choosing replacement windows and doors?

A4: Look for energy-efficiency ratings, products that match your home design, guarantee choices, and reviews of the product and installation service.

Q5: Is it worth the investment to change old doors and windows?

A5: Yes, the long-lasting advantages of improved energy efficiency, comfort, and curb appeal can make this upgrade a wise financial investment for lots of house owners.
